在现代 Web 应用开发中,表单处理是一个常见且重要的任务。Vue 作为一款流行的前端框架,提供了简便而强大的方式来处理表单验证和提交。
一、Vue 表单组件
Vue 的表单组件使开发人员能够轻松地构建和管理表单。通过使用这些组件,可以定义表单字段、设置验证规则,并与用户输入进行交互。
二、验证规则
定义验证规则来确保用户输入的正确性和完整性。这可以包括必填字段检查、格式验证(如电子邮件地址)、长度限制等。
三、实时验证
在用户输入时进行实时验证,提供即时反馈。这有助于用户快速了解输入的问题,并减少错误提交的可能性。
四、错误消息
当验证失败时,显示清晰明确的错误消息,告知用户问题所在。
五、提交表单
处理表单的提交事件。在此,可以进行数据验证的最终检查,并根据结果执行相应的操作,如发送表单数据到服务器进行处理。
六、与后端集成
通过 HTTP 请求将表单数据发送到后端服务器,并处理服务器的响应。
七、验证逻辑的封装
将验证逻辑封装为可复用的组件,提高代码的可维护性和扩展性。
八、处理异步验证
对于需要与服务器进行异步验证的情况(如检查用户名是否唯一),可以使用 Promise 或其他异步处理方式。
九、安全性考虑
防止跨站请求伪造(CSRF)等安全问题,确保表单提交的安全性。
十、用户体验优化
在设计表单和处理验证时,要考虑用户体验。例如,提供清晰的指示和易于理解的错误消息。
通过使用 Vue 进行表单验证和提交,可以提高开发效率,提供更好的用户体验,并确保表单数据的正确性和安全性。在实际开发中,根据具体需求和业务逻辑,合理运用上述技术和方法,将能够构建出稳定、高效的表单处理功能。
以上是一篇关于“表单处理:使用 Vue 进行表单验证和提交”的文章示例,你可以根据实际需求进行修改或调整。